Biography
As a Redshirt Junior in 2009-10: One of four Broncos who started in all 34 games for the NCAA Champions… Named second-team All-CCAA…An All-CCAA Tournament selection… Named NCAA West Region All-Tournament… Needs just 26 blocks to become CPP’s all-time leader… Led the CCAA in blocks (1.3 ppg)… Finished second in scoring (9.7 ppg) and led the team in rebounds (5.6)… Led CPP in scoring with 13 points in NCAA title game over 2nd-ranked Indiana, Pa.… Scored title game’s final points on a baseball pass dunk and a pair of FTs inside final 40 seconds… Got hot at the right time when he fired 70 percent from the field on 42-of-60 shooting in the six postseason contests entering the NCAA Elite Eight highlighted by his 15 points with career-high three 3-pointers vs. BYU Hawaii in NCAA West Region title game… Earned one of the team’s two double-doubles with 17 points/12 rebounds at Chico State.
As a Junior in 2008-2009: Sustained knee injury and served a medical redshirt... Has two remaining seasons of eligibility.
As a Sophomore in 2007-2008: Appeared in 27 games with 20 starts… Fourth in scoring with 7.5 points/game and third in rebounds (4.8/game) for the Broncos… Ranked 10th in the CCAA in steals/game (1.3) and 5th in blocked shots/game (1.52)… Earned one double-double for the season with 11 points and season-high 10 rebounds at CS Monterey Bay (2/1/08)… Scored season-high 13 points twice – vs. Humboldt State (1/25/08) and Chico State (2/16/08)… Reached double figures in scoring nine times… Dealt season-high six assists at Cal State Dominguez Hills (2/9/08)… Led team in blocks for second straight season (41 with season-best four twice – vs. Le Moyne (12/30/08) and UC San Diego (1/18/08).
As a Freshman in 2006-2007: Stellar freshman year capped by becoming the second Bronco in as many years to be named CCAA’s Freshman of the Year (Larry Gordon in 2005-2006)… Named to Division II Bulletin All-Freshman Team… Played in 27 games with three starts… Averaged 5.7 points a game and 4.6 rebounds/game… Led club in blocked shots with 24… Ranked second in offensive rebounds with 44… Earned acclaim with 19 points and three steals in 73-60 road victory over Chico State (2/17/07)… Other double-figure scoring effort was 11 vs. Cal State L.A. (3/2/07)… Grabbed season-best 11 rebounds vs. CS Stanislaus (1/12/07).
High School: Graduated from Cajon High School... Named the San Andreas League’s Most Valuable Player and earned first-team All-San Bernardino County honors… Multiple all-Tournament teams selection during his high-school career… Averaged 17 points, 10 rebounds and three assists per game… Competed in track and field.
Personal: Son of Hurshal Booker and Zara Terrell… Communications and Business Marketing double major… Enjoys eating and sleeping.
